Tiger earns its stripes in second quarter

PERTH (miningweekly.com) – Dual-listed copper miner Tiger Resources has reported record production for the month of June, with some 4 422 t of copper in concentrate produced, driving a record quarterly production.

The ASX- and TSX-listed miner noted that during the three months to June, the company produced 11 116 t of copper in concentrate, bringing its production for the first half of the year to 20 604 t.

The record production has also resulted in Tiger upgrading its 2013 production guidance to between 41 000 t and 43 000 t, compared with the previous estimate of 37 000 t.

Tiger is currently undertaking the phased development of its Kipoi project, in the Democratic Republic of Congo, where the Stage 1 heavy media separation plant was in production.

The Stage 1 operation would produce stockpiles with 147 000 t of contained copper, which would provide feedstock for the Stage 2 solvent extraction electrowinning plant for the first three years of its operation.

Construction of the Stage 2 plant started in January this year and was on schedule for first production in mid-2014.
